CSDRC is a grassroots group of all ages that share the same ideas to promote and build legal offroad bicycle trails. These trails include: Pumptrack, Dirtjumps, Cycloross tracks, short track, single track, skills areas and connective trails. As of now we only have permission to build a small pump track and one dirt jump line, but our long term goal is to promote the sport to groups of all ages and

display a level of stewardship for our public trails that will in turn allow us to promote cycling to the entire BCS Community and beyond. We recently have been decommissioned by the city of College Station. The pump track and dirt jumps no longer exist. We hope to bring cycling to the College Station community in the future.

We are currently looking for an alternate location for the dirt at this park. The dirt was purchased by several teenagers with part time jobs and full time school work. We have spent roughly $1500 of our own money and $800 of donations on dirt from local companies. If anyone has a temporary place we can hold the dirt until we find a place that would be awesome as well. We are being kicked out at the end of October and have to remove it all ourselves.

We would like to address some of the concerns that have come out from the park. The first is the biggest one: liability. The city (right fully so) is concerned with the liability of the park. However, Texas Law protects the government from any sort of liability issue. Chapter 75, Sec .002 states that the owner of the land (The City of College Station) does not assume responsibility or incur liability for any injury to any individual (cyclist, pedestrian or spectator) or property (bicycle, bicycle equipment, etc.) caused by any act of the person to whom permission is granted or to whom the invitation is extended. This section has been questioned before about whether or not it includes cycling and it does. It defines "recreation" in Section .001, which includes cycling (article M). Section .002 then refers back to that definition of "recreation". Through this law the city would not be responsible for injuries occurring at the park. http://www.statutes.legis.state.tx.us/Docs/CP/htm/CP.75.htm
